public class MainAbilitySlice extends AbilitySlice { @Override public void onStart(Intent intent) { super.onStart(intent); super.setUIContent(ResourceTable.Layout_ability_main); //1. 找到组件 Button button = (Button) this.findComponentById(ResourceTable.Id_button); //2. 绑定单击事件 button.setC...
Component but1 = (Button) findComponentById(ResourceTable.Id_but1); //2.给按钮绑定单击事件,当点击后,就会执行 MyListener 中的方法,点一次执行一次 // 而方法就是下面点击的内容 but1.setClickedListener(new MyListener()); } @Override public void onActive() { super.onActive(); } @Override publ...
一、第一种写法:在XML文件中声明onClick属性(很少用) 在XML文件中显式指定控件的onClick属性,点击按钮时会利用反射的方式调用对应Activity中的onClick()方法。 (1)xml文件代码如下: 1 <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" 2 xmlns:tools="http://schemas.android.com/too...
自定义单击事件监听类: publicclassTestButtonActivityextendsActivity { Button btn1, btn2; Toast tst;classMyClickListenerimplementsOnClickListener { @OverridepublicvoidonClick(View v) {//TODO Auto-generated method stubswitch(v.getId()) {caseR.id.button1: tst= Toast.makeText(TestButtonActivity.this,...
Button单击事件的四种写法: 1、第一种写法:匿名内部类 附上代码: public class MainActivity extends Activity{ private Button btn ;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); ...
单击事件的四种写法 [在这里插入图片描述] 1...findComponentById(ResourceTable.Id_but1); //2.给but1绑定单击事件,当事件被触发后,就会执行本类中的onClick方法,this就代表本类...void onClick(Component compo...
51CTO博客已为您找到关于鸿蒙单击事件的四种写法的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及鸿蒙单击事件的四种写法问答内容。更多鸿蒙单击事件的四种写法相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
(3.1)HarmonyOS鸿蒙单击事件4种写法 简介:(3.1)HarmonyOS鸿蒙单击事件4种写法 第二种和第四种常用 实现步骤: 1.通过id找到组件。 2.给需要的组件设置单击事件。 3.实现ClickedListener接口。 4.重写onClicked方法。 第一种,自定义实现类(在当前类外面写实现类)...
[19] day2-02-单击事件-代码实现 1404播放 12:59 [20] day2-02-单击事件-代码实现 1400播放 12:59 [21] day2-03-单击事件的代码分析 1710播放 08:00 [22] day2-04-单击事件的四种写法 1231播放 待播放 [23] day2-04-单击事件的四种写法 1259播放 11:29 [24] day2-05-双击事件 1741播...